    CellTech

    Total Calories 300_
    _ _
    Calories From Fat 0_ _ _
    Total Fat 0_ g 0%___
    Saturated Fat 0_ g 0%___

    Cholesterol 0_ mg 0%___
    Sodium 60_ mg 3%___
    Potassium 150_ mg 4%___

    Total Carbohydrates 75_ g 25%___
    Dietary Fiber 0_ g 0%___
    Sugars 75_ g _

    Protein 0_ g 0%___

    Vitamin C 250_ mg 417%___
    Calcium 20_ mg 2%___
    Phosphorus 100_ mg 10%___
    Magnesium 70_ mg 18%___


    Chromium Picolinate 300_ mcg 250%___
    Creatine Monohydrate 10_ g _
    Taurine 2_ g _
    Alpha Lipoic Acid 200_ mg

    Ingredients: Dextrose, Creatine Monohydrate, Taurine, Natural and artificial flavors, Malic acid, Red beet powder, Dipotassium phosphate, Disodium phosphate, Magnesium phosphate, Ascorbic Acid, Lipoic Acid, coloring agent, Chromium Picolinate.

    "CELL-Tech provides 10 grams of HPLC-tested pure Creatine Monohydrate per serving. After ingestion of creatine monohydrate, the human body experiences a 50% creatine receptor-cite downgrade, peaking after approximately 6 hours.1 As a result, large doses of Creatine (up to 10 grams) will need to be consumed over a period of time to maximize cellular uptake. The inclusion of a nutraceutical dose of Dextrose (75g) is the same dosage advocated by the World Health Organization (W.H.O.) for physicians to assess the efficiency of Insulin production in potential Diabetic patients.2 This dosage may maximize Insulin output, which is necessary for optimum Creatine uptake.3 Sports Nutrition experts and trainers alike realize that Insulin is the most anabolic hormone in the body. Once stimulated, it drives carbohydrates, amino acids (protein), and Creatine Monohydrate molecules into muscle cells. For this reason, MuscleTech has added a powerful insulin potentiator Alpha Lipoic Acid which has been recently used in type II Diabetics to control blood glucose4 Based on preliminary research results, this substance appears to boost the Insulin-signaling pathway within the muscle cell.5 MuscleTech has added Chromium Picolinate, Potassium, Phosphates, Taurine, Ascorbic Acid, and Magnesium to further potentiate the actions of Insulin transport and muscle cell contraction.6 "

    V12 is a brand new creatine supp.

    "Tricreatine Malate is a highly soluble creatine salt that provides much greater increase in creatine bioavailability over regular creatine monohydrate. This compound is creatine bound to malic acid. Malic acid is a naturally occurring kreb cycle intermediate, meaning that malic acid plays a crucial role in our natural energy producing cycle. Malic acid coupled with the effect of creatine as in Tricreatine Malate offers much greater ATP production over conventional creatine monohydrate. Additionally this creatine salt will not make you hold subcutaneous water like creatine monohydrate would since there is no water molecule in its chemical structure. All hydration will occur in the muscle cell. Also, Tricreatine Malate does not cause stomach discomfort and does not need to be loaded."
